23 year old Todd Williams is a player/partier who lives a care free life and has a care free attitude. As most of his friends and other women, who have had experience with that side of him, refer to him as a "player" since a teen but when he "plays" too hard one day he sees that he shouldn't have and now has nothing. When he has to start over he meets Christina who is a 22 year old workaholic. Despite their different circumstances, she's in need of help as he is. When they move in together, they realize how different they are, will they put those differences aside and act like adults or will they ignore them? Read to find out.
